Charlie Nicholas believes Rangers defender and reported Wolves target Calvin Bassey could set other clubs back £25 million this summer.

The 22-year-old has been in fantastic form for the Scottish giants in recent months.

He made plenty of headlines last week for putting in a colossal performance against Eintracht Frankfurt in the Europa League final.

He then followed that up with another brilliant display against Hearts in the Scottish Cup final.

Bassey’s stock has certainly soared lately.

And Nicholas reckons Rangers could rake in £25 million for the player this summer, which would help them rebuild.

He wrote in his Scottish Express column: “I can see Rangers getting £25 million if they sell Calvin Bassey to fund their summer rebuild.

“You can see why Steven Gerrard at Aston Villa are so keen to get him but there will be a string of top clubs looking at him.

“I think the minimum value would be in the £25 million bracket.”

And why does Nicholas believe he could be worth that much?

“The reason why I put him in that range is because he is already a better player than Tyrone Mings,” he added.

“He was one that was built up and has ended up becoming an England international but I look at Bassey and I think there is more.”

Wolves are supposedly one of a few clubs showing interest in Bassey according to the Daily Record.

Aston Villa, Brentford and Fulham are also apparently keen.

Nicholas has been so impressed with Bassey, that he also called him the best young player in Scotland.

This is a real rave review from Nicholas, who also went on to say that he would be ‘amazed’ if Bassey stayed at Rangers beyond the summer.

It could be very difficult for Wolves to land him in the next window.

He is clearly hot property after a brilliant season.

It’s difficult to see Wolves splashing £25 million on a defender, as much as many fans would love to see it.

He would make a great replacement for Romain Saiss. But Bruno Lage does also have Toti Gomes who is looking very promising.
